Installation Steps According to the Manual

Step 1: Prepare Your Garage

  • Clear the area around the garage door and ceiling.
  • Ensure the door is balanced and operates smoothly manually.
  • Verify the electrical power source is available near the opener installation site.

Step 2: Assemble the Rail

  • Connect the rail sections included in your Craftsman 1/2 Hp Garage Door Opener kit.
  • Attach the trolley and chain or belt according to the manual.
  • Ensure smooth operation along the rail before mounting.

Step 3: Mount the Motor Unit

  • Position the motor unit on the ceiling, centered with the garage door.
  • Use a level to ensure horizontal alignment.
  • Secure the unit to ceiling joists or support brackets using the hardware provided.

Step 4: Install the Header Bracket

  • Mark the header location above the garage door.
  • Drill pilot holes and attach the bracket securely.
  • This bracket supports the front end of the rail and trolley assembly.

Step 5: Connect the Rail to the Motor Unit

  • Slide the rail into the motor unit and secure with bolts.
  • Attach the chain or belt to the trolley arm.
  • Verify that the trolley moves smoothly along the rail.

Step 6: Attach the Trolley Arm to the Garage Door

  • Connect the trolley arm to the door bracket on the top panel.
  • Adjust the arm length according to the manual for proper operation.

Step 7: Install Safety Sensors

  • Mount sensors on both sides of the door, approximately 6 inches above the floor.
  • Align the sensors and connect the wires to the motor unit.
  • Test the sensors to ensure the door stops and reverses properly when obstructed.

Step 8: Wire the Wall Control Panel

  • Mount the wall panel near the garage entrance.
  • Connect wires according to the manual and secure them neatly.
  • Test the panel for proper operation before proceeding.

Step 9: Program Remote Controls

  • Follow the manual to program the remote controls to the motor unit.
  • Test all remotes to ensure responsiveness and range.

Step 10: Test the Garage Door

  • Operate the door using the wall panel and remotes.
  • Adjust travel limits and force settings as necessary.
  • Lubricate moving parts if recommended in the manual for smoother operation.

Maintenance Tips from the Manual

Proper maintenance ensures the longevity and safe operation of your Craftsman opener:

  • Lubricate the chain, rollers, and hinges every six months.
  • Inspect brackets, bolts, and fasteners regularly.
  • Test safety sensors monthly to ensure functionality.
  • Replace worn or damaged parts promptly.
  • Keep the emergency release cord accessible and functional.

Common Troubleshooting Issues

Even with proper installation, issues may arise. The Craftsman 1 2 Hp Garage Door Opener Manual 41A5021 provides guidance for resolving common problems:

  • Door Doesn’t Open or Close: Check power, remote batteries, and sensor alignment.
  • Opener Makes Noise: Tighten loose hardware and lubricate the chain or belt.
  • Door Reverses Unexpectedly: Adjust force and travel settings.
  • Remote Control Issues: Reprogram remotes or replace batteries.

Safety Precautions

Safety is critical when operating or maintaining a garage door opener:

  • Keep hands, fingers, and tools away from moving parts.
  • Do not attempt repairs on springs or cables; these are under high tension.
  • Use a sturdy ladder and ensure proper footing during installation or maintenance.
  • Disconnect power before servicing the opener.
